Springboks to play Tests against Georgia in Gauteng

SA Rugby has confirmed that the two Tests against Georgia, as a precursor to the series against the British and Irish Lions, will be played in Gauteng.

The Springboks will make their return to action at Loftus Versfeld in Pretoria on Friday, the second of July, in the first Test against Georgia.

It will also be their first outing since the Rugby World Cup final on 2nd November 2019 and Jacques Nienaber’s debut as head coach.

The second Test against Georgia is scheduled for Ellis Park, a week later.

Both matches will kick off at seven o’clock in the evening and due to COVID-19 regulations, no spectators will be allowed to attend.
